German | In Silber über zwei blauen Wellenbalken drei deichselförmig gestellte grüne Weidenblätt. |
English | blazon wanted |
Origin/meaning
The arms were officially granted on January 7, 1993.
The three willow leaves represent the three municipalities in the Amt. The willow is a very common tree in the area. The two wavy bars represent the Elbe and Pinnau rivers in the Amt.
